Steps to Obtain Energy Star Certification

Obtaining Energy Star certification involves a detailed process to ensure that a building meets the necessary energy efficiency standards. Each step must be carefully executed for successful certification.

Using the Portfolio Manager Tool

The Portfolio Manager is an essential tool for measuring energy performance.

Enter Your Building Data

Accurate data entry is crucial. Users must gather information on energy consumption, building size, and occupancy. This data forms the foundation for calculating the energy score.

Analyze Your Energy Use

Once data is entered, the Portfolio Manager analyzes energy usage patterns. This analysis helps identify opportunities for efficiency improvements.

Achieving the Required Score

A minimum score of 75 is needed to qualify for certification. This score indicates that the building performs better than 75% of similar structures.

Verification by a Licensed Professional

After achieving the required score, a licensed professional must verify the accuracy of the submitted information. This verification is crucial to ensure compliance with Energy Star standards.

Annual Verification and Renewal

Annual verification is mandatory to maintain certification. This involves:

  • Conducting a thorough review of energy consumption data with the Portfolio Manager tool.
  • Engaging a licensed professional to validate the performance metrics.
  • Submitting updated application documentation to the EPA.

Renewal of certification must be handled promptly to ensure ongoing benefits.
